non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material

Non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material represents a revolutionary advancement in textile technology, combining the benefits of traditional cotton with modern manufacturing processes. This innovative material consists of three distinct layers engineered to deliver superior performance across multiple applications. The construction involves bonding fibers together through mechanical, thermal, or chemical processes rather than weaving or knitting, resulting in a fabric that maintains structural integrity while offering enhanced functionality. The outer layers typically feature high-quality cotton fibers that provide softness and absorbency, while the middle layer acts as a reinforcement core, creating a balanced combination of strength and comfort. This non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material demonstrates exceptional versatility in medical, cosmetic, and industrial sectors. The manufacturing process eliminates the need for traditional yarn production, allowing for precise control over fiber orientation and density distribution. Each layer serves a specific purpose: the top layer ensures gentle contact with surfaces, the middle layer provides structural stability and additional absorption capacity, and the bottom layer offers secure adhesion or backing support. The material exhibits remarkable consistency in thickness and density, making it ideal for applications requiring uniform performance. Advanced production techniques enable manufacturers to customize the material properties, including absorption rates, tensile strength, and surface texture. The non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material maintains breathability while preventing fiber migration, ensuring reliable performance throughout its intended lifespan. Quality control measures during production guarantee that each batch meets stringent specifications for purity, sterility, and performance characteristics. This material technology represents a significant improvement over traditional single-layer alternatives, offering enhanced durability, better moisture management, and superior user experience across diverse applications.

Superior Multi-Layer Absorption Technology

Superior Multi-Layer Absorption Technology

The non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material incorporates cutting-edge multi-layer absorption technology that revolutionizes liquid management and retention capabilities. This sophisticated engineering approach creates three distinct functional zones within a single pad structure, each optimized for specific performance characteristics. The top layer features specially treated cotton fibers with enhanced wicking properties that rapidly draw moisture away from contact surfaces, preventing pooling and ensuring immediate absorption response. The middle layer consists of a high-density fiber matrix designed to trap and retain absorbed liquids, preventing back-flow and maintaining dry surface conditions throughout extended use periods. The bottom layer provides a moisture barrier function while maintaining breathability, ensuring that absorbed materials remain contained within the pad structure. This technological advancement delivers absorption rates up to 300% higher than traditional single-layer alternatives, making the non woven fabric 3 ply cotton pad material exceptionally efficient for medical procedures, cosmetic applications, and industrial cleaning tasks. The engineered fiber orientation creates capillary channels that distribute liquids evenly across the pad surface, maximizing utilization of available absorption capacity. Advanced bonding techniques ensure that the three layers work in harmony without delamination or separation, maintaining structural integrity under pressure and movement. The absorption technology accommodates various liquid viscosities, from thin solutions to viscous compounds, demonstrating remarkable versatility across applications. Quality testing protocols verify that each pad maintains consistent absorption performance throughout its rated capacity, providing users with reliable and predictable results. This innovation significantly reduces the quantity of pads needed for specific tasks, improving operational efficiency while reducing waste generation and associated costs.
